To the release manager: I'm passing ownership of the Pellwick deep-link router to Sorrel before the 4.2 cut. The intent-matching table now lives in the Farrowgate config service; stale entries were purged last sprint. Watch the fallback route — it silently swallows malformed slugs, which inflated our drop-off metrics in March. The staging resolver needs its keystore unlocked before each regression pass, and that keystore accepts only one credential. For the signing vault, the recovery phrase is noted directly below.

recovery phrase for tafog-fafog: novix-novdor-fraath-brieth-olieth-oliix-rusix-wenion-julax-druox

Ticket: Dark-mode support for the Kestrelboard admin dashboard.

Scope: theme toggle, persisted preference, updated contrast tokens. No new data flows; preference stored client-side only. CSP unchanged. Third-party chart widget restyled, no script changes. Pen-test note: verify no theme param injection in the settings route. Blocking release until security review is complete. Sign-off required from the reviewer named below.

named custodian: Brivan Eliath Quenox Frador

Ticket: Crashfall ingest failing on staging

New folks, please read carefully. The Pebblekit mobile app's crash reports aren't reaching the symbolication queue because staging's env file was copied without its upload credential. Symptoms: 401s in the collector logs every five minutes. To fix, add the missing line to the env file, exactly as follows.

secret setting of fafop-tagep: VAULT_KEY29=6a815d21e2d77cc25ef1802d73ee6

Subject: Quickstore 4.2 — bloom filter now fronts the KV layer

Plugin authors: starting with this release, Quickstore places a bloom filter ahead of the key-value store. Negative lookups return faster; false positives fall through safely. No API changes are required on your side. Verify your plugin against the staging build referenced below.

session token of fahif-tadup = htk3_9c7